Which is the coldest planet? [S.S.C. Online CHSL (T-1) 22.01.2017(Shift-2)](a) Neptune(b) Venus(c) Uranus(d) JupiterCorrect Answer: (c) UranusSolution:The coldest planet in our solar system is Uranus.Why Uranus is the Coldest:Uranus has an average temperature of -224°C (-371°F), making it the coldest despite Neptune being farther from the Sun.This is because Uranus gives off very little internal heat, unlike other gas giants.Submit Quiz« Previous12345Next »
